Output 386660165f95779e55e404adeeedf20a9705ab35690e8a54fc392e63fa73184f:0

value
2709974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7699717709b14e43d54e521b4b5bf7abc8ce0b50 OP_EQUAL
address
3CW7UbrZxjrRpwNMdyRpqCDfpTPjTYqBZu
transaction
386660165f95779e55e404adeeedf20a9705ab35690e8a54fc392e63fa73184f
spent
true